Output 852d5f1992f4d70437500323d080fd81fc459ffb9e53eb2da42c3fdb25e118c8:2

value
5397343
script pubkey
OP_0 OP_PUSHBYTES_20 ac579c35c1507763e940f6442c6c2e8b7c5c4fe2
address
bc1q43tecdwp2pmk862q7ezzcmpw3d79cnlzqs7vpm
transaction
852d5f1992f4d70437500323d080fd81fc459ffb9e53eb2da42c3fdb25e118c8